Rittersporn

Rittersporn  (Delphinium)

Rittersporn ist eine große Gattung einjähriger und ausdauernder Pflanzen, die sich für die Verwendung im Garten ausgezeichnet eignen. Der Rittersporn ist in verschiedenen Höhen erhältlich. Die hohen Pflanzen müssen oft hochgebunden werden. Geben Sie dem Rittersporn einen sonnigen Standort auf fruchtbarem Boden mit viel organischem Material. Um die Pflanzen vital zu halten, müssen Sie sie alle paar Jahre teilen und an einer anderen Stelle im Garten wieder einpflanzen. Schneiden Sie den Rittersporn nach der ersten Blüte kräftig zurück und düngen Sie ihn. Oft folgt dann eine zweite Blüte im Spätsommer. Der Rittersporn braucht Nachbarpflanzen, die ebenfalls ausgeprägte Farben haben, wie Taglilie (Hemerocallis), Sonnenhut (Echinacea) und Garbe (Achillea). Leider finden Schnecken den Rittersporn überaus schmackhaft, streuen Sie darum schon früh im Frühjahr umweltfreundliches Schneckenkorn um die Pflanzen herum.

General information about Larkspur (Delphinium):
Larkspur (Delphinium) is a large genus of annual and perennial plants which are very much suited to the garden. They come in differing heights. The taller varieties will often need staking. Plant Larkspur in a sunny spot, in fertile soil which has plenty of organic matter. In order to keep Larkspur strong and healthy it is advised to dig them up every few years and split them. Also it is best to re-plant them somewhere else in the garden. After its first flowering, cut Larkspur well back and add some fertilizer. Often you will be treated to a second flowering in late summer. Larkspur look good planted with Day Lily (Hemerocallis), Coneflower (Echinacea) and Yarrow (Achillea). Unfortunately, slugs and snails are also attracted to Larkspur. Early in spring, spread some biological slug pellets around the plants.
